An exemplary example of teaching with our Dragon Eggs Series…

Observe how the reader practises decoding, but also encounters new words that develop vocabulary. Note the exemplary teaching: how the teacher makes sure new words are explained and that decoding is accurate. A great example of the Simple View of Reading: Reading comprehension = word recognition (decoding) X language comprehension. Thank you Sarah Horner for this fantastic example!

Dragon Eggs series is a series of 10 decodable books for emerging readers who need to revisit vowel digraphs. This series is for readers who are not quite fluent and need a little extra reading practice.
